Low-emissivity glass

Low-emissivity glasses are a form of passive solar control coating that permits you to manage the amount of heat that is transferred through your windows. This can add to your heating costs and also aid in improving the insulation of your home.

Depending on how it's installed, low-e glass can block heat from your home and can even aid in retaining heat. A soft coating of low-e glass is more efficient in energy than a hard coat.

Unlike the conventional type of glazing, low-e coatings feature an extremely thin layer of material that deflects ultraviolet and infrared light. The coating helps reduce the heating system's burden by blocking longer wavelengths.

There are a variety of reasons your double-glazed windows could develop condensation. The most frequent culprits include humid air and warm temperatures. Cooking may also contribute to this issue.

The best way to go about this is to contact an established double glazing company in Macclesfield. They will assess your windows to determine if they drain properly. They can also inject anti-fogging agents into your window. This can improve its performance and appearance.

It is also possible to replace the glass unit, which could be accomplished in less than an hour. This is a less expensive and efficient method than replacing all your double-glazed windows.
